All residence homestead owners are allowed a $40,000 residence homestead exemption from their home's value for school taxes. 4.2. County taxes. If a county collects a special tax for farm-to-market roads or flood control, a residence homestead is allowed to receive a $3,000 exemption for this tax.

On June 30, the Denton County Commissioners Court approved a residence homestead exemption of up to 1 percent or $5,000 ...Property tax exemptions must be filed with the Collin County Central Appraisal District. Exemption applications are available online at the Collin Central Appraisal District ( CAD) website and need to be filed by April 30. There is no fee to apply for an exemption through the Central Appraisal District and any questions should be directed to ...The typical deadline for filing a county appraisal district homestead exemption application is between January 1 and April 30. A Texas homeowner may file a late county appraisal district homestead exemption application if they file no later than one year after the date taxes become delinquent. It is an assessment valuation based on agrucultural use. Collin County landowners may apply for special appraisal based on their land's productivity value rather than what the land would sell for on the open market.
